User Experience Monitoring

What is User Experience Monitoring?

User Experience Monitoring (UEM) in click fraud protection involves tracking and analyzing the interactions and experiences of users when they engage with advertisements and web content. This monitoring helps detect invalid clicks and fraudulent activities by providing insights into user behavior, ensuring that advertisers can optimize their campaigns effectively and mitigate losses caused by click fraud.

How User Experience Monitoring Works

User Experience Monitoring utilizes various tools and metrics to analyze user interactions with advertisements. It tracks behaviors such as clicks, time spent on ads, and the flow of users through conversion funnels. By analyzing this data, businesses can identify patterns of legitimate and fraudulent clicks, allowing for better-targeted campaigns and reduced losses from click fraud.

Data Collection

UEM involves collecting data from various sources, including web analytics, user session recordings, and engagement metrics. This data serves as the backbone for understanding user behavior and discerning potential click fraud activities.

Behavior Analysis

Using advanced algorithms, UEM analyzes user behavior to differentiate between legitimate clicks and malicious ones. This analysis can highlight discrepancies in user interactions, helping identify patterns indicative of click fraud.

Real-Time Monitoring

Real-time monitoring enables businesses to respond swiftly to suspicious activities. Alerts can be generated to notify advertisers of unusual patterns, allowing for immediate investigation and action to prevent further fraud.

Reporting and Insights

Comprehensive reporting tools provide businesses with insights into user interactions, click performance, and conversion rates. These insights help in refining targeting strategies and improving the overall effectiveness of ad campaigns.

Types of User Experience Monitoring

  • Session Recording. This method allows businesses to watch real-time recordings of user sessions, giving insight into user interactions with ads and identifying any irregularities that may suggest click fraud.
  • Heatmaps. Heatmaps visually represent user engagement on web pages, highlighting areas of high activity. This information helps in understanding user behavior and identifying what attracts legitimate users versus fraudulent activity.
  • Funnel Analysis. This type of monitoring tracks user movements through conversion paths, helping to identify where potential fraud occurs, enabling businesses to optimize their strategies to reduce losses.
  • User Feedback. Direct user feedback mechanisms like surveys and reviews provide insights into user opinions, allowing businesses to gauge the effectiveness of their ads and improve the user experience while detecting suspicious clicks.
  • Performance Metrics. Monitoring key performance indicators, such as click-through rates (CTR) and conversion rates, helps in identifying anomalies that may indicate click fraud, ensuring that ad budgets are spent effectively.

Algorithms Used in User Experience Monitoring

  • Anomaly Detection Algorithms. These algorithms analyze user behavior and flag activities that deviate from established patterns, thus helping in identifying potential fraudulent clicks.
  • Machine Learning Models. These models are trained on historical data to predict and identify fraudulent behavior in real-time based on user interactions and sessions.
  • Behavioral Classification Algorithms. These algorithms classify user clicks as either legitimate or fraudulent by analyzing user behavior patterns and engagement levels.
  • Pattern Recognition Algorithms. By recognizing patterns of behavior in user interactions, these algorithms can help in detecting suspicious activities associated with click fraud.
  • Regression Analysis. This statistical method is used to identify relationships between user behavior data and click outcomes, enabling the prediction of fraudulent patterns based on various user engagement metrics.
